Abstract

Techniques for securing authentication credentials on a client device during submission in browser-based cloud applications are disclosed. In one particular embodiment, the techniques may be realized as a method for securing authentication credentials on a client device comprising: detecting, on the client device, display of an authentication form in a browser window associated with a first flow to a target server; accessing, on the client device, one or more authentication credentials associated with a user of the client device; and submitting, to the target server, the one or more authentication credentials via a second flow to the target server.
